Subject: Northern Region Sales Review — quick heads-up

Hi all,

Thanks for pulling the branch numbers together so fast. Overall the Harwick and Dunlea branches beat target, while Ostermoor slipped about 6% — mostly the delayed Fenwick Pro launch. We'll walk through the details on Thursday's call, so branch managers, please have your pipeline notes ready. Nothing alarming, but a few trends worth discussing in person. Before the call, please read the plan summary that follows.

confidential, yajog-tageg: The southern region missed its Zorius quota by 3.5 percent last quarter. Quenethek Systems plans to raise the Lamwyn list price by 65.7 percent in March. The steering committee signed off on a budget of $145.3 million for Project Giliel. The renewal with Praionox Freight closes at $236.1 million a year, 44.6 percent below the last contract.

Handover note — TideGlance widget

Support team: as of this sprint, maintenance of the TideGlance tide-table widget moves from the Coastal Apps group to Platform UI. Known quirks: the widget caches tide predictions for 6 hours, so stale data reports within that window are expected behavior. The Port Merrow feed occasionally drops minutes past midnight; a retry runs automatically at 00:15. Escalate anything else directly. The name of the new owner follows below.

signatory, bahaf-hawip: Rusix Sorir Drumir Belius

14:07 — Veltrow tax-rate cache began serving stale entries after the Pinemarsh region sync failed silently. 14:19 — Checkout totals in three storefronts showed outdated rates. 14:26 — Cache flushed manually; rates corrected. 14:40 — Root cause traced to a TTL misconfiguration in the Ledgertide deploy from that morning. Support should reference the deploy in question using the build token recorded below.

pipeline stamp: htk9_ce63042d9

# Break-Glass: Catalog Cache Invalidation

Scope: the Pinrow product catalog at Veldstone Retail. If stale prices persist after a purge and the Hollowmere invalidation queue is wedged, use break-glass to flush the edge tier directly. Contractors: get verbal sign-off from the catalog lead first. Steps: open the Hollowmere admin shell, select emergency-flush, confirm the tenant, and run it once — repeated flushes thrash the origin. Access is logged and expires after 20 minutes. Unseal the admin shell with the passphrase below.

recovery phrase for kahop-tajog: istix-casvan